Radeon HD 5830
The Radeon HD 5830 is manufactured by AMD. It was released in February 25 2010. It features the TeraScale 2 architecture. The core clock speed is 800 MHz. It has 1120 shading units. The thermal design power (TDP) is 175W. Manufactured using 40 nm process technology. G3D Mark benchmark score: 1,726 points.

Radeon RX Vega 11 Processor
The Radeon RX Vega 11 Processor is manufactured by AMD. It was released in May 10 2018. It features the GCN 5.0 architecture. The core clock ranges from 300 MHz to 1251 MHz. It has 704 shading units. The thermal design power (TDP) is 35W. Manufactured using 14 nm process technology. G3D Mark benchmark score: 1,769 points.
Graphics Performance
The Radeon HD 5830 scores 1,726 and the Radeon RX Vega 11 Processor reaches 1,769 in the G3D Mark benchmark — just a 2.5% difference, making them near-identical in rasterization performance. The Radeon HD 5830 is built on TeraScale 2 while the Radeon RX Vega 11 Processor uses GCN 5.0, both on 40 nm vs 14 nm. Shader units: 1,120 (Radeon HD 5830) vs 704 (Radeon RX Vega 11 Processor). Raw compute: 1.792 TFLOPS (Radeon HD 5830) vs 1.761 TFLOPS (Radeon RX Vega 11 Processor).
| Feature | Radeon HD 5830 | Radeon RX Vega 11 Processor |
|---|---|---|
| G3D Mark Score | 1,726 | 1,769+2% |
| Architecture | TeraScale 2 | GCN 5.0 |
| Process Node | 40 nm | 14 nm |
| Shading Units | 1120+59% | 704 |
| Compute (TFLOPS) | 1.792 TFLOPS+2% | 1.761 TFLOPS |
| ROPs | 16+100% | 8 |
| TMUs | 56+27% | 44 |
